Technical Field
The utility model belongs to the technical field of tableware processing equipment and specifically relates to a stainless steel round-bottomed frying pan welded fastening device.
Background
The stainless steel frying pan needs to process the spoon head and the spoon handle respectively firstly in the processing procedure, then welds both, and because the characteristics that the spoon head is more slick and sly, the spoon handle is more slender lead to both not being convenient for fix in welding process, in case the location between the two is inaccurate will lead to welding angle and position error to influence product quality. Therefore, a stainless steel tableware welding device is developed by the company, the spoon head and the spoon handle can be respectively positioned when the frying pan is welded, and the operation is convenient; the range of location is adjustable, can adapt to the frying pan of multiple size to obtain utility model patent protection, the patent number is: 201921322304.4. the device is more convenient to weld than before when being used daily, but still has some problems, such as the spoon head and the spoon handle are in the same straight line, but the device can only lead the spoon handle to be lapped on the spoon head, and whether the spoon head and the spoon handle are in the same straight line or not needs the judgment of a welding worker by virtue of experience, so that errors are difficult to avoid; the third supporting rod and the arc-shaped plate structure can exert downward pressure on the spoon handle, but the volume of the spoon handle is large, and the space for installation and welding operation of the device is influenced sometimes.
SUMMERY OF THE UTILITY MODEL
In order to overcome the technical problem, the utility model provides a stainless steel frying pan welded fastening device can make spoon head, spoon handle be in on same straight line when welding, saves the space of device installation and welding operation.
The utility model provides a technical scheme that its technical problem adopted is: a stainless steel frying pan welding and fixing device comprises a base; the front part of the top surface of the base is connected with a first telescopic rod, the top end of the first telescopic rod is hinged with a first carrying plate, and a first fastening knob for fixing the angle of the first telescopic rod and the first carrying plate is arranged at the hinged position of the first telescopic rod and the first carrying plate; a sliding groove is formed in the rear portion of the top surface of the base and corresponds to the first telescopic rod, a supporting rod capable of moving horizontally along the sliding groove is mounted on the sliding groove, and a second fastening knob for fixing the supporting rod in the sliding groove is sleeved on the supporting rod; the top end of the supporting rod is connected with a second carrying plate, one end of the second carrying plate, which is far away from the first carrying plate, is provided with a stop block, and the stop block can abut against the rear end of the spoon handle to prevent the spoon handle from sliding backwards; the top surface of the first carrying plate is provided with three spoon head positioning devices, one spoon head positioning device is positioned on the front side of the first carrying plate, and the other two spoon head positioning devices are positioned on the left side and the right side of the first carrying plate; the rear side of the bottom surface of the first carrying plate is connected with a connecting rod, the connecting rod is connected with a second telescopic rod, the top end of the second telescopic rod is connected with a limiting block through a rotating shaft, and a third fastening knob for fixing the angle of the rotating shaft is arranged on the side surface of the limiting block; the top surface of stopper is equipped with the recess, and the longitudinal section of recess is wide isosceles trapezoid down, the recess is located same straight line with the first spoon head positioner who is located first year thing board front side, and the spoon handle can block and realize spacingly in the recess to it is in same straight line to have ensured spoon head and spoon handle.
The top surface of the limiting block is provided with a blind hole, a cross rod is arranged above the limiting block, a pressing block is arranged above the bottom of the cross rod corresponding to the groove, the bottoms of two ends of the cross rod are connected with inserting rods capable of being inserted into the blind hole, and the top of the cross rod is provided with a handle; the pressing block can be pressed tightly in the groove by pressing the cross rod downwards to further fix the spoon handle, and the structure is small in size and saves space.
The spoon head positioning device comprises a screw rod, a sliding sheet, a fastening nut and a positioning sheet; the surface of the first object carrying plate is provided with three screws, each screw is provided with a slip sheet with a through groove, the screws are inserted into the through grooves of the slip sheets and can move along the length direction of the through grooves, fastening nuts for fixing the relative positions of the screws and the through grooves are sleeved on the screws, and one end of each slip sheet facing the center of the first object carrying plate is connected with two positioning sheets with an included angle of 130 degrees; the spoon head can be placed on the first object carrying plate, then the positions of the three sliding sheets are adjusted, the fastening nut is screwed, and the six positioning sheets are used for fastening and clamping the spoon head, so that the positioning of the spoon head is realized.
The first carrying plate is of a plate-shaped structure with a rectangular or square cross section and corresponds to the shape of a spoon head; the second carrying plate is of a strip-shaped structure with a rectangular cross section and corresponds to the shape of the spoon handle.
The welding and fixing device for the frying pan has the advantages that the spacing block structure is arranged, so that the pan head and the pan handle are positioned on the same straight line when being welded, the error is favorably reduced, and the quality of finished products is improved; the operation is convenient, the positioning amplitude is adjustable, and the frying pan can adapt to frying pans with various sizes; the limiting block is small in size, and the space for installation and welding operation of the device is saved.

Detailed Description
In order to make the objects, technical solutions and advantages of the present invention more apparent, the present invention is further described in detail with reference to the following embodiments.
Referring to fig. 1-3, the present embodiment provides a welding and fixing device for a stainless steel wok, comprising a base 1; the front part of the top surface of the base 1 is connected with a first telescopic rod 2, the top end of the first telescopic rod 2 is hinged with a first carrying plate 3, and a first fastening knob 4 for fixing the angle of the first telescopic rod 2 and the first carrying plate 3 is arranged at the hinged position of the first telescopic rod 2 and the first carrying plate 3; a sliding groove 5 is arranged at the rear part of the top surface of the base 1 and corresponds to the first telescopic rod 2, a supporting rod 6 capable of horizontally moving along the sliding groove 5 is arranged on the sliding groove 5, and a second fastening knob 7 for fixing the supporting rod 6 at the position of the sliding groove 5 is sleeved on the supporting rod 6; the top end of the supporting rod 6 is connected with a second carrying plate 8, and one end of the second carrying plate 8, which is far away from the first carrying plate 3, is welded with a stop dog 9 which is used for abutting against the rear end of the spoon handle 22; the top surface of the first object carrying plate 3 is provided with three spoon head positioning devices 10, one of the spoon head positioning devices is positioned on the front side of the first object carrying plate 3, and the other two spoon head positioning devices are positioned on the left side and the right side of the first object carrying plate. The first carrying plate 3 is of a plate-shaped structure with a rectangular or square cross section and corresponds to the shape of the spoon head 21; the second carrying plate 8 is a strip-shaped structure with a rectangular cross section and corresponds to the shape of the spoon handle 22.
The spoon head positioning device 10 comprises a screw, a sliding sheet, a fastening nut and a positioning sheet; the surface of the first object carrying plate 3 is provided with three screws, each screw is provided with a slip sheet with a through groove, the screws are inserted into the through grooves of the slip sheets and can move along the length direction of the through grooves, fastening nuts for fixing the relative positions of the screws and the through grooves are sleeved on the screws, and one end of each slip sheet facing the center of the first object carrying plate 3 is connected with two positioning sheets with an included angle of 130 degrees; the spoon head 21 can be placed on the first object carrying plate 3, then the positions of the three sliding sheets are adjusted, the fastening nut is screwed, and the six positioning sheets are used for fastening and clamping the spoon head, so that the positioning of the spoon head 21 is realized.
In order to keep the spoon head 21 and the spoon handle 22 on a straight line, the connecting rod 11 is welded on the rear side of the bottom surface of the first carrying plate 3, the connecting rod 11 is connected with the bottom end of the second telescopic rod 12 through a screw, the top end of the second telescopic rod 12 is connected with the limiting block 14 through the rotating shaft 13, and the side surface of the limiting block 14 is provided with a third fastening knob for fixing the rotating angle of the rotating shaft 13; the top surface center of stopper 14 is equipped with recess 15, recess 15 and the first spoon head positioner 10 that is located first year thing board 3 front side are in same straight line, and spoon handle 22 can block and realize spacing in recess 15 to the spoon head has been ensured to be in same straight line with the spoon handle.
The longitudinal section of the groove 15 is an isosceles trapezoid with a wide upper part and a narrow lower part, and the spoon handle can be suitable for spoon handles with various widths.
In order to further fix the spoon handle 22, blind holes 16 are formed in two sides of the top surface of the limiting block 14, a cross rod 17 is arranged above the limiting block 14, a pressing block 18 is connected to the bottom of the cross rod 17 above the corresponding groove 15, insertion rods 19 capable of being inserted into the blind holes 16 are connected to the bottoms of two ends of the cross rod 17, and a handle 20 is mounted at the top of the cross rod 17; the handle 20 can be held by hand to press the cross rod 17 downwards, so that the pressing block 18 tightly presses the spoon handle 22 in the groove 15 to play a further fixing role, and compared with the prior patent, the structure has small volume and saves more space.
When the utility model is used, the spoon head 21 is fixed on the first carrying plate 3 by the spoon head positioning device 10, and the proper height and angle are adjusted; then the tail end of the spoon handle 22 is placed on the second object carrying plate 8 and abuts against the front part of the stop block 9, the part, close to the head end, of the spoon handle 22 is clamped in the groove 15, the head end of the spoon handle 22 is lapped at the welding position of the spoon head 21, the inserted link 19 is inserted into the blind hole 16, and the cross rod 17 is pressed downwards to enable the pressing block 18 to tightly press the spoon handle 22 in the groove 15; fixing is completed, and welding is carried out; after welding, the handle 20 is held and pulled upwards, the inserting rod 19 is pulled out from the blind hole 16, and then the spoon handle 22 is taken out from the groove 15.
